Historical Context of Maritime Firepower
Understanding the evolution of naval firepower is essential to grasp how maritime assaults have transformed over the centuries. From the early days of wooden ships armed with rudimentary cannons to the sophisticated fleets of today equipped with advanced missile systems, the journey of naval firepower reflects not only technological advancements but also shifts in military strategy and geopolitical dynamics. In the age of sail, naval battles were often decided by the number of cannons a ship could carry and the skill of its crew in maneuvering them. The introduction of gunpowder revolutionized naval warfare, allowing ships to engage enemies from a distance, reducing the need for hand-to-hand combat on the decks.
As we move through history, we see the impact of industrialization in the 19th century, which brought about ironclad warships and steam power. These innovations significantly increased the firepower and mobility of naval forces. The American Civil War showcased the power of ironclads, where the USS Monitor and CSS Virginia engaged in a historic battle that marked the end of the wooden warship era. The ability to withstand enemy fire while delivering devastating blows changed the landscape of naval warfare forever.
Fast forward to the 20th century, and we witness the full-scale integration of aviation into naval operations. Aircraft carriers became the new battleships, projecting power far beyond the horizon. The Pacific Theater during World War II highlighted the crucial role of firepower in maritime strategy, with battles like Midway demonstrating how air superiority could decisively influence naval engagements. The introduction of guided missiles in the latter half of the century further transformed naval firepower, enabling ships to strike targets hundreds of miles away with pinpoint accuracy. This shift not only changed how battles were fought but also how nations approached their maritime strategies.

Modern Naval Guns
In the ever-evolving theater of naval warfare, stand as a testament to technological advancement and strategic necessity. Gone are the days when ships relied solely on broadside cannons, as contemporary naval artillery has transformed into sophisticated systems capable of delivering precision strikes with remarkable accuracy. These guns are not just about firepower; they represent a fusion of advanced targeting systems, automation, and integration with other military assets.
Today's naval guns are designed to engage a variety of targets, from surface ships to aerial threats. A prime example is the 5-inch/54 caliber gun, which has been a workhorse for the U.S. Navy for decades. Its versatility allows it to fire guided projectiles, enhancing its effectiveness against both land and sea targets. The introduction of the Advanced Gun System (AGS), utilized on the Zumwalt-class destroyers, has further pushed the boundaries of naval artillery. This system is capable of firing long-range projectiles with precision, showcasing how modern naval guns can support ground forces during maritime operations.
Moreover, the integration of computerized fire control systems has revolutionized how naval guns are operated. These systems utilize real-time data to calculate the optimal firing solution, taking into account factors such as wind speed, humidity, and the ship's movement. This level of automation not only increases the rate of fire but also minimizes human error, making naval guns more lethal than ever before. For instance, the Phalanx Close-In Weapon System (CIWS) employs radar-guided technology to track and engage incoming missiles and aircraft, providing a last line of defense for naval vessels.

Historical Artillery Developments
Throughout the ages, the evolution of naval artillery has been nothing short of revolutionary, marking significant turning points in naval warfare. From the early days of wooden ships armed with rudimentary cannons to the sophisticated guided missile systems of today, the journey of artillery development is a fascinating tale of innovation and adaptation. In the 15th century, the introduction of gunpowder changed the landscape of naval engagements forever. The primitive cannons of that era laid the groundwork for future advancements, allowing ships to engage enemies from a distance rather than relying solely on boarding tactics.
As we moved into the 19th century, the development of rifled artillery began to reshape naval tactics. These guns, with their spiral grooves, provided greater accuracy and range, enabling naval commanders to strike with precision. This period also saw the introduction of steam power, allowing ships to maneuver more effectively during battles, which in turn influenced the design and deployment of artillery. The advent of ironclad warships in the mid-1800s further pushed the boundaries of artillery effectiveness, necessitating the development of more powerful and destructive weapons.
The 20th century witnessed a dramatic leap in artillery technology, particularly during the World Wars. The introduction of rapid-fire guns and automatic loading systems meant that ships could unleash a barrage of firepower in a short amount of time, significantly altering engagement strategies. For instance, battleships equipped with 16-inch guns became the dreadnoughts of their time, capable of delivering devastating fire from miles away. This era also marked the beginning of guided munitions, which would eventually lead to precision strikes that could hit targets with remarkable accuracy.

Missile Systems and Their Impact
In the ever-evolving landscape of naval warfare, missile systems have emerged as game-changers, redefining how battles are fought at sea. These systems provide naval forces with the ability to strike from a distance, delivering devastating payloads without the need for close engagement. Imagine a chess game where one player can attack pieces from across the board; that’s the kind of strategic advantage missile systems bring to maritime operations.
Historically, the introduction of missile technology marked a significant shift in naval tactics. No longer were ships merely floating artillery platforms; they became mobile launchers capable of delivering precision strikes. This shift has made it crucial for naval commanders to rethink their strategies, as the threat of missile attacks can deter enemy actions and shape the course of engagements.
Modern missile systems can be classified into several categories, each with its unique capabilities and roles in maritime assaults:
- Anti-Ship Missiles: Designed to target enemy vessels, these missiles can be launched from ships, submarines, or aircraft, allowing for a multi-dimensional attack approach.
- Land-Attack Missiles: These missiles extend the reach of naval forces, enabling them to strike land-based targets while keeping a safe distance from enemy defenses.
- Ballistic Missiles: Although primarily associated with strategic land warfare, some naval platforms are equipped to launch ballistic missiles, providing unparalleled range and destructive capability.
The operational effectiveness of missile systems is not solely dependent on their firepower but also on the integration of advanced targeting and guidance technologies. Modern systems utilize sophisticated radar, satellite navigation, and even artificial intelligence to enhance accuracy and reduce collateral damage. This technological leap has led to a paradigm shift where precision becomes as critical as firepower itself.
